Core Features:

Precise Mold Design: These molds are meticulously designed to produce intricate and precisely shaped components for automotive headlights, including the lens, housing, and various integrated features.

Material Compatibility: Plastic auto headlight molds are crafted to work with various materials, including polycarbonate, acrylic, and other thermoplastic polymers. The choice of material depends on the specific requirements of the headlight design.

Advanced Manufacturing: The molds themselves are manufactured using advanced CNC machining and 3D printing technologies to ensure high precision and repeatability.

Versatile Designs: These molds can create a wide range of headlight designs, from traditional halogen lamps to modern LED and laser-based lighting systems.
